Preview of tonights Match against Hamilton Accies at New Douglas Park. Kick Off 19:45.
Hamilton manager Billy Reid has a clutch of new players available for his team's first Clydesdale Bank Premier League game at home to Dundee United on Monday night. Sebastian Sorsa, the 24-year-old Finnish winger who signed a one-year contract with the Lanarkshire club, is the latest recruit to Reid's squad. Other summer arrivals Sean Murdoch, Mark Corcoran, Derek Lyle, Lucas-Jordan Akins and Brian Carrigan are also in contention. Dundee United have only two injury absentees for the game. Long-term injury victims Craig Conway, who has been recovering from a broken foot, and Keith Watson (knee) are edging back to fitness but the start of the season has come too soon. New signing Roy O'Donovan will join fellow summer arrivals Warren Feeney, Francisco Sandaza, Scott Robertson, Paul Dixon, Andis Shala and Michael McGovern in the squad to play the SPL new-boys.
